What does it mean to love?In this richly detailed and thoughtful memoir, author Rosaland Thornton explores the lessons and ideas that have echoed through her life. Born in the Southwest after World War II, she was raised in a family shaped by generations of poverty and struggle. Religion and obedience were absolute. As she grew, she began to see the world around her and to wonder how she might experience life differently. A beautiful marriage shone a light on the traditions of her past and showed her a new shape for her future.Touched by wars and a witness to sweeping social changes and historic events, the lonely child grew through pain to find love and to journey beyond loss. Her poignant story spans decades of history and is told with humor, fairness, and wisdom. Read more
